In the pursuit of a radiant smile, many individuals are turning to aesthetic teeth veneers as a transformative solution. These ultra-thin shells, crafted from either porcelain or composite resin materials, are meticulously designed to cover the front surface of teeth, thus enhancing their appearance. The growing popularity of veneers is attributed to their ability to address a variety of dental concerns, ranging from discoloration to misalignment, while offering a natural look. As a result, aesthetic teeth veneers are becoming a go-to option for those seeking a flawless, confident smile.

Understanding Aesthetic Teeth Veneers

Aesthetic teeth veneers are not just a cosmetic enhancement; they are a comprehensive approach to dental aesthetics. They offer numerous benefits:

  • Durability and Longevity: Veneers are known for their strength and can last for many years with proper care.
  • Stain Resistance: Porcelain veneers, in particular, are resistant to stains, helping maintain a bright smile.
  • Natural Appearance: These veneers mimic the light-reflecting properties of natural teeth, providing a seamless look.
  • Customizable: Veneers can be tailored to match the shape, size, and color of natural teeth.

The Process of Getting Veneers

The journey to a perfect smile with veneers involves a few key steps:

Consultation and Assessment

The first step is a thorough dental examination to determine if veneers are the right solution. This involves assessing the overall health and structure of the teeth. During this phase, it?s crucial to discuss the desired outcome and any specific concerns.

Preparation

Once the decision is made to proceed, the teeth are prepared for the placement of veneers. This typically involves the removal of a small amount of enamel from the surface of the teeth. Impressions are then taken to create a precise mold used in fabricating the veneers.

Bonding

Who Can Benefit from Veneers?

Veneers are suitable for individuals with a range of dental imperfections, including:

  • Discolored or stained teeth that do not respond to traditional whitening methods.
  • Chipped or broken teeth that require a cosmetic fix.
  • Gaps between teeth that affect the smile?s symmetry.
  • Misaligned or irregularly shaped teeth that impact overall aesthetics.

Maintaining Your Veneers

Proper care is essential to maintain the longevity and appearance of veneers:

  • Practice good oral hygiene by brushing twice daily and flossing regularly.
  • Avoid biting or chewing on hard objects that could damage the veneers.
  • Schedule regular dental check-ups to monitor the condition of the veneers.
  • Limit consumption of staining foods and beverages to preserve the veneers? natural look.
